Indian Army Conducts Motivational Tour for Youth to Kargil & Drass

Srinagar: Vajr Division of the Indian Army organised a Capability Building Tour to Kargil to inspire and educate the youth about the nation’s history and heritage and sacrifices given by Army to safeguard it. A total of 35 students accompanied by three teachers from Higher Secondary Schools of Trehgam & Drugmulla block of Kupwara district embarked on a motivational tour. The students were officially flagged off by Maj Gen K Mohan Nair, YSM, SM, GOC, 28 Infantry Division at Udaan School, Drugmulla on 16 October 2024. This program was organised to commemorate the Rajat Jayanti of Kargil Vijay Diwas wherein soldiers laid their life to safeguard Jammu & Kashmir from Western Adversary. This three day/ ni tour was aimed at visit to the Kargil War Memorial, Drass where the students were briefed about the operations undertaken by the Indian Army during the 1999 Kargil War to push out the Pakistani infiltrators.

Day one of the tour was completely focussed on visit to Kargil town & one forward locality to provide insights into operations undertaken during Operation VIJAY.

The students also visited Heritage village at Hunderman to provide glimpses of rich culture. On the second day the students paid tribute at the central feature of the Kargil War Memorial at Drass -a wall of pink sandstone bearing a brass plaque engraved with the names of soldiers who gave their lives during Operation VIJAY.

They also visited the Captain Manoj Pandey Gallery, which honours soldiers posthumously awarded the Param Vir Chakra for their exemplary bravery during the conflict and the Kargil museum. The students were also taken to the Tibetan market at Drass for shopping & cultural insights.

The visit left an indelible impression on the young minds, instilling in them a sense of Patriotism and administration for the Armed Forces. The tour included a short halt at Sonamarg to provide the glimpses of natural beauty of the place.

The tour aimed at enriching the students’ knowledge about the pivotal role of community members in guarding the country’s borders in the unforgiving terrain of the region.

The Indian Army’s initiative to organise such motivational tour reflects its commitment to nurturing youth, fostering national integration and contributing the nation building.
